Oligoether complexes of alkaline-earth metal ions. III. Structures of 2,5,8,11,14,17-hexaoxaoctadecane (`pentaglyme`) complexed with calcium, strontium and barium thiocyanates

Y. Y. Wei, Bernard Tinant, J. P. Declercq, M. Van Meerssche, Johannes Dale

Open publisher page 8 citations

Abstract

[Ca(SCN) 2 (C 10 H 22 O 5 )]•H 2 O, [Sr(SCN) 2 (C 10 H 2 O 5 )]•H 2 O et [Ba(SCN) 2 (C 10 H 22 O 5 )]•H 2 O cristallisent dans le systeme triclinique, groupe d'espace P1 et leur structure est affinee respectivement jusqu'a R=0,046, R=0,058 et R=0,028
